Many times, if pet owners are told their cat had a heart attack or died of a heart attack, it's a layman's term for the cat having cardiomyopathy, which literally translates to heart muscle disease. this autoimmune disease inflames the heart muscle, which prevents it from generating the normal force of contraction and affects how well it pumps. If heart function is significantly impaired by cardiomyopathy, this will lead to heart failure (often called congestive heart failure), where there is compromise to blood flow through the heart and blood output from the heart.
